Abstract

The embodiment of the invention discloses a smart television control method and device. The smart television control method is applied to a mobile terminal. The method can comprise the following steps: receiving information about a display state of a region where a current focal position of a smart television is located transmitted by the smart television through a wireless connection; determining a display mode corresponding to the display state from a plurality of preset display modes; displaying a control interface corresponding to the determined display mode on a screen of the smart television; receiving a control instruction sent by the user on the control interface; and sending the control instruction to the smart television. Through application of the technical scheme provided by the embodiment of the invention, a user can finish operations and controls of the smart television with the mobile terminal. Moreover, the mobile terminal is a tool being frequently used by the user, thereby making operations easier and improving the operation and control experiences of the user.

The Intelligent television control method that the embodiment of the present invention provides, is applied to mobile terminal, this mobile terminal and intelligent television wireless connections.First the wireless connections of mobile terminal and intelligent television are described.
In embodiments of the present invention, mobile terminal issue the transmission of the control command of intelligent television can based on privately owned DLNA protocol realization.The full name of DLNA is DigitalLivingNetworkAlliance, DLNA, be intended to solve PC, consumer appliances, mobile terminal interconnect interior wireless network and cable network, what make Digital Media and content service unconfinedly to share and growth becomes possibility.Mobile terminal and intelligent television are the equipment supporting DLNA.
The connection procedure of mobile terminal and intelligent television sums up and can comprise following process:
First: device discovery procedure.
Mobile terminal, for the control of intelligent television, can realize by installing client in the terminal.
When the client in mobile terminal just starts, or when forwarding front stage operation to by running background, starting device discovery feature;
When the client in mobile terminal exits, or when proceeding to running background by front stage operation, interrupting device discovery feature.
In actual applications, the duration of the device discovery procedure of mobile terminal can be limited according to actual conditions, as being defined as 4 seconds.Mobile terminal automatic finishing equipment in this duration finds, if mobile terminal does not find the equipment supporting DLNA in this duration, then can not enter equipment connection process below.
Second: equipment connection process.
In device discovery procedure, after mobile terminal finds the equipment of support DLNA, can access arrangement connection procedure.In actual applications, an intelligent television can set up wireless connections with multiple mobile terminal simultaneously, and a mobile terminal can only set up wireless connections with an intelligent television simultaneously.
In embodiments of the present invention, mobile terminal can set up wireless connections with intelligent television in the following manner:
When only there is an intelligent television in the local area network (LAN) detecting self place, set up wireless connections with this intelligent television;
When there is plural intelligent television in the local area network (LAN) detecting self place, judge in described plural intelligent television, whether to there is self last intelligent television connected, if existed, then set up wireless connections with this intelligent television, otherwise, according to the selection of user, the intelligent television selected with user sets up wireless connections.
3rd: equipment disconnects process.
Under former arbitrary scene, mobile terminal all disconnects with intelligent television:
When mobile terminal or intelligent television leave local area network (LAN), or, when the client in mobile terminal is closed, or, when the client in mobile terminal forwards running background to by front stage operation, or, when mobile terminal or intelligent television are closed.
Shown in participation Fig. 1, be the implementing procedure figure of a kind of Intelligent television control method that the embodiment of the present invention provides, the method is applied to mobile terminal, can comprise the following steps:
S110: the information receiving the show state of its region, current focus position that intelligent television is sent by wireless connections;
Intelligent television is provided with state detector, can detect the show state of region, current focus position.After mobile terminal and intelligent television set up wireless connections, the show state of region, current focus position can be sent to mobile terminal by wireless connections by intelligent television.
Be summed up, the show state of the region, focal position of intelligent television mainly contains following three kinds of states: character input state, video broadcasting condition and information display state.
Such as, intelligent television is adjusted, pack up keyboard, when intelligent television current presentation view shows searched page, login page or enrollment page etc., all can be used as character input state.In these cases, the information of character input state is sent to mobile terminal by intelligent television.Concrete, input in intelligent television current presentation view or when deleting certain character, be synchronized to mobile terminal.
For another example, intelligent television enters the played in full screen state of video, and whether current playing progress rate, the displaying video of displaying video are chain broadcast video etc., all can be used as video broadcasting condition.In these cases, the information of video broadcasting condition is sent to mobile terminal by intelligent television.
Other states except character input state and video broadcasting condition can be used as information display state.In actual applications, which kind of state is the state at the displaying interface of intelligent television be specially, and can pre-define according to actual conditions, the embodiment of the present invention repeats no more.
The focus of intelligent television, can be understood as concern centrostigma.Such as, under the character input state of intelligent television, the focus of intelligent television is cursor, and under the video broadcasting condition of intelligent television, the focus of intelligent television is the video pictures of played in full screen.
After mobile terminal receives the information of the show state of its region, current focus position that intelligent television is sent by wireless connections, the operation performing step S120 can be continued.
S120: from the multiple display modes preset, determine the display mode corresponding with described show state;
In the terminal, can preset multiple display mode, as Trackpad pattern, keyboard mode, Broadcast Control pattern etc., different display modes can correspond to the different show state of intelligent television.When mobile terminal receives the information of the show state of region, intelligent television current focus position, from the multiple display modes preset, the display mode corresponding with show state can be determined.

When mobile terminal detects the gesture operation that user performs in the control inerface corresponding with Trackpad pattern, can identify the gesture of user, in order to determine the vector of initial position when touching body click mobile terminal screen to the final position touched when body leaves mobile terminal screen.With n second for computing unit, complete and click if n touches body in second and leave, can be designated as and once slide.Click if n did not complete in second and leave, can dragging be designated as.When dragging, the position touching body when every n second to end according to this n second with touch body first time press time the vector travel direction of original position judge, interval n here can carry out arranging and adjusting second as the case may be, is such as set to 1 second.
The vector that gesture identification is determined, can determine gesture direction by the coordinate system according to Fig. 3 further.In the coordinate system shown in Fig. 3, initial point can be any point in the touch area of control inerface, and the transverse axis of coordinate system is parallel with the Width of mobile terminal screen, and the longitudinal axis of coordinate system is parallel with the short transverse of mobile terminal screen.With 45 °, each quadrant for gesture identification can be become following direction by boundary:
[+315 ° ,+45 °), be identified as right direction;
[+45 ° ,+135 °), be identified as upward direction;
[+135 ° ,+225 °), be identified as left direction;
[+225 ° ,+315 °), be identified as in downward direction.
Certainly, in actual applications, specifically which direction is which angle correspond to, and can adjust according to actual conditions.

User clicks the broadcasting/pause button in Play Control region 560, can control intelligent television for the broadcasting of video or time-out.When video in intelligent television is in broadcast state, button in mobile terminal screen in Play Control region 560 is shown as the icon of two vertical line pattern, when video in intelligent television is in halted state, the button in mobile terminal screen in Play Control region 560 is shown as the icon of triangular pattern.
User clicks the Volume up button in volume adjustment region 550, and can control the volume that intelligent television increases video playback, accordingly, user clicks the volume down button in volume adjustment region 550, can control the volume that intelligent television reduces video playback.
The play time of current video in intelligent television and total duration can be shown in progress viewing area 540, user drags the progress bar in progress viewing area 540, the progress of the current displaying video of intelligent television can be controlled, concrete, the time point that the time point determination fast forwarding and fast rewinding that mobile terminal can drag according to user is concrete, to send corresponding operational order to intelligent television.
In album picture viewing area 530, show the surface plot of the special edition play in intelligent television, this surface plot can show, as 480*270 according to the size preset.For a certain collection/phase video, the surface plot of this collection/phase special edition can be used.User can slide left or to the right in album picture viewing area 530, functional equivalent is in dragging progress bar, surface plot can float layer by progress displaying, mobile terminal can according to the duration of the touch body sliding distance determination F.F. of user or rewind, when the total duration of video is greater than 2 minutes, ultimate range may correspond to 1% of the total duration of fast forwarding and fast rewinding, and when the total duration of video is not more than 2 minutes, ultimate range may correspond to the total duration in video.User can upwards or slide downward in album picture viewing area 530, and functional equivalent is in adjustment volume.

Intelligent television can set up wireless connections with multiple mobile terminal, when the type of the control command received is identical, performs after the control command received can being merged.Such as, the control command received is progress adjustment instruction, and one is progress F.F. instruction, and one is progress rewind instruction, and intelligent television determines progress adjustment size after these two control commands being merged, and performs.
When the type of the control command received is not identical, intelligent television can perform according to the sequencing of the control command received the control command received successively.
